Mastering Flight Path Analysis and Drop Zone Control
The definitive momentum of a match is established the moment the countdown timer hits zero and the plane crosses the map layout. Experienced competitors analyze the trajectory immediately to predict where the majority of rival squads will choose to land. By mapping out potential high-congestion zones, you can deliberately select a calculated drop that offers ample loot with reduced initial risk.
Perfecting your diving speed and directional control guarantees that your feet hit the ground ahead of nearby opponents. Securing high-tier weaponry and armor in the opening seconds allows you to dictate the terms of engagement early on. Establishing control over your immediate surroundings provides peace of mind as the play zone begins its initial collapse.
Executing Strategic Rotations and Map Awareness
Surviving until the final circles demands a profound understanding of spatial mechanics and geographic placement rather than just swift aim. Keeping a close eye on the minimap allows you to track sound cues, red dots, and dynamic safe zone shifts accurately. Anticipating enemy movements along common chokepoints enables your squad to move early and secure superior high-ground positions.
Effective movement involves utilizing natural cover like rocks, ridges, and buildings to break line of sight during transitions. Relying on sudden, unpredictable movement patterns prevents snipers from pinning your team down in vulnerable open fields. Developing high levels of situational consciousness ensures that your rotations always remain one step ahead of the shrinking border.
